Rarely available to the market is this historic and elegant five bedroom detached Edwardian villa, built in 1904, it has been a much-loved family home for the past 18 years.

It’s where the current owners brought up their young family, celebrated countless milestones, and enjoyed everyday life in its welcoming, light-filled spaces. The property retains all the charm of its era, with high ceilings, generously proportioned rooms, and beautiful leaded and stained glass in the entrance hall and reception rooms. It has also been thoughtfully updated for modern living, featuring a spacious kitchen and family room at the heart of the home. From the back of the house, and from the hall and landing, there is a wonderful south-west outlook over Japanese-inspired gardens, complete with an authentic teahouse. Whether hosting friends in the reception rooms or relaxing in the private, mature garden, this is a home made for year-round enjoyment.
The home has five bedrooms all well sized and bright as well as two bathrooms.
The downstairs space offers four reception rooms and a vast entrance hallway. The open plan kitchen, living and dining space overlooks the large rear garden.
The house is situated in Egham Town Centre.
Egham has a wide variety of shops, coffee shops, pubs and restaurants as well as a choice of supermarkets.
There are superb transport links with mainline railway access to London Waterloo in approximately 40 minutes as well as the M25, M3 and M4 close by. Heathrow airport is not far away either for business or leisure travel.
The area is blessed with the stunning Windsor Great Park which has an abundance of different walks.
